Moon River Music Festival 2019: Jason Isbell, Brandi Carlile Headline Chattanooga's Premier Event
Founded in 2014 by musician Drew Holcomb, the annual Moon River Music Festival is a family-friendly, two-day celebration showcasing Tennessee's rich music and culture. Originally held in Holcomb's hometown of Memphis, it has evolved into a beloved Tennessee tradition. Now in its fifth year—and second consecutive year at the scenic Coolidge Park in Chattanooga—the festival continues delivering curated music lineups and community-driven experiences. Expect 20-22 national acts across two stages, plus local food vendors.
Lineup Highlights
Jason Isbell & The 400 Unit
Jason Isbell & The 400 Unit deliver electrifying live shows that blend raw energy with deep emotional resonance. Fans pack venues like Nashville's Ryman Auditorium and New York's Beacon Theatre, creating an atmosphere of shared passion and rock 'n' roll camaraderie.
Brandi Carlile
Brandi Carlile's album "I Forgive You" explores radical acceptance and unconditional love—profound themes beyond simple reconciliation. Her powerful songwriting and performances captivate audiences worldwide.
Drew Holcomb and the Neighbors
As the festival's founding band, Drew Holcomb and the Neighbors bring heartfelt Americana and folk-rock to the stage. Their authentic sound and engaging live sets make them a festival cornerstone.
